Output 149a043205da9254354fd3c1a1bfdfc3b319dc2073eb0ee1602d5af953a6736f:1

value
2031607
script pubkey
OP_0 OP_PUSHBYTES_20 38d316b7690aa057a90f1b41fed4933497ea9cd4
address
bc1q8rf3ddmfp2s902g0rdqla4ynxjt748x57uq0r7
transaction
149a043205da9254354fd3c1a1bfdfc3b319dc2073eb0ee1602d5af953a6736f
spent
true